When Will This Cool/Unsettled Pattern Change?


It's not uncommon for April to feature stalled low pressure with long stretches of "cool" air across the Great Lakes/New England.  Our long stretch of warmth a few weeks ago makes this cooler/cloudy/rainy pattern that much harder to deal with.  What does the long range (2-3 week outlook) say?

The southern oscillation index went through some significant changes over the last week and a half. The greater these day-to-day changes the stronger the effect across North America, Here is the peer reviewed research:  PAPER HERE


SOI analog forecast show the Great Lakes/Eastern US trough backing off by mid month.  How quickly will the Southeast ridge build back is the big question.


Another element going forward this summer and fall will be the building El Nino. I'm not going to go into the specifics of that here. Perhaps a blog post on this in the weeks and months ahead. But as La Nina decays, the overall effects will be cascading across the Pacific augmenting the jet stream and the weather across North America.

Watch the decaying La Nina as shown through the weekly sea surface temperature anomalies from December 2022 to mid April 2023:  Watch the blue area disappear slowly.

Sea Surface Temperature Anomalies

The big drivers of the pattern change have been the ridge of high pressure in the Gulf of Alaska and the western corners of North America along, the deep low pressure over the Aleutian islands and the stalled ridge over Greenland (negative North Atlantic Oscillation). The position of these high pressure ridges have allowed low pressure to undercut them through the middle of the US. This has significantly suppressed the Bermuda high which brought us the warmth a couple weeks ago locking in below normal temperatures across the eastern 2/3 of the US.

Based upon all of these factors, I don't foresee any long stretches over warmth across the Great lakes and Ohio valley through at least the middle of May.  


The reinforcing front Sunday/Monday of next week could produce rain/snow mix.  Here was my forecast tweet from April 20 on the early May rain/snow mix potential.


As of this writing (April 25) the new EURO and GFS models show the Greenland Ridge & western North America ridge (red areas) holding strong until the second week of May then gradual weakening. This flattens the trough across the central US bringing an end to the unsettled pattern. These solutions were indicated on the SOI analogs more than a week ago.


Temperatures per the GFS also corroborate what the SOI analogs indicated 2 weeks ago.  That is gradual improvement across the central US and Ohio Valley but still no big signs of any long stretches of warmth.

Snow to 80s in April. How Often Does This Happen?

Snow showers this morning. Yes, it's April 19th

Hinckley

Twinsburg






April snow is not that uncommon. Look at the snow history from Late March through April. These are the individual instances of snow for EACH DAY since April 3rd color coded. 


Yet this week temperatures will be jumping significantly heading into the weekend. (SOI forecast from April 5th seems to be working out). 

SOI Changes in early April connect with these historical weather conditions


All of this means we could go from accumulating snow to 80 in a little over 4 days. When was the last time this happened?  LAST YEAR

I was surprised to find this has happened almost 60 times since 1950! The fastest SNOW to 80s was 19 hours in April 3-4, 2007

How about 80s to snow?  Only 10 times. Most recently in 2018


Big temp swings in March and April occur with high frequency vs other months. These big changes occur in the central US more than in the Great Lakes.

Angry Lake Erie and Unseasonably Cold Temperatures

 


Strong NE winds developed Thursday and Friday which piled up water in the western basin of Lake Erie. Video above is from Kelley's Island Friday courtesy Todd Neu.

Wave heights reached 10-15 feet before they settled down Saturday and Sunday


The low resembled a late fall, cut-off system. You can see how it developed over the upper midwest and then stalled in the southern Great Lakes.


Temperature started out 20+ degrees below normal Saturday morning across the Great Lakes.



High temperatures Saturday stayed in the lower 50s north and upper 50s south. Temperatures this cool (under 55) don't happen very often this late in the year.

Why The Abrupt Cooler Pattern in the Northeast?

After the warmest April on record in places like Cleveland, Ohio and across much of the Ohio Valley and much of the eastern US, the pattern has not only reverted back to spring, it took several steps back resembling elements of winter. Throughout April, this high pressure ridge stayed east which allowed the ridge across the eastern US to build allowing above normal temperatures. Many were fooled into thinking that summer was here and we were in the clear to plant gardens. Not so fast!

Look at April temperatures versus the 30 year average:

Now look at the first week or so of May per the American model (GFS).

Why the sudden flip?  In this case, we have to look over Greenland for the answer.

Remember that across the mid-latitudes, troughs and ridges (valleys and peaks in the upper levels of the atmosphere) travel like a fluid through the atmosphere. When one location is lucky enough to be blanketed by a ridge, fair weather typically is the result. Once the succession of trough and ridges is changed by an interruption in the wave pattern, the weather will change at the surface. These changes (too much to go into here. See Southern Oscillation Index) often originate over the Pacific Ocean and propagate east. Currently, these changes are reflected over the northern Atlantic and Greenland.

Notice the red (high pressure) at the top inching west blocking/stalling the blue (low pressure systems) over the NE
We can quantify the strength of this ridge using the NAO of the North Atlantic Oscillation.  The more negative the index goes, the stronger the Greenland ridge. The NAO has been forecasted to drop close to -300. Historically this has only happened once in the month of May since record keeping began.  That was back in 1993.

NAO drops to -300 soon


But be warned, historically, this pattern over Greenland in May doesn't always produce a cold and rainy May. Look at the high temperatures in Cleveland during these years of record low May NAO:


Look at the resultant upper level pattern across the US in each of these years. All but 1948 and 2008 show dominant warmth.

May 1948 - DOMINANT COLD OVER GREAT LAKES/NEW ENGLAND

MAY 1951 - WIDESPREAD WARMTH ACROSS US. COLDER SOUTHWEST

MAY 1962 -  WIDESPREAD WARMTH ACROSS US

MAY 1980 - WIDESPREAD WARMTH ACROSS US

MAY 1993 - MORE US WARMTH. COLDER DEEP SOUTH


MAY 2008 - MUCH OF US BELOW NORMAL

The NAO this low (or any other index) isn't always a great predictor of temperature and the overall pattern. 

Unfortunately, unlike any of the previous instances of strongly negative NAO in May, this cold is locked in for at least another week.  So get ready for rain, scattered frost and perhaps some light snow!
